Frequently Asked Questions About Roofing in Viola

Get answers to common questions about roofing services in Viola, Illinois.

1What is the typical cost range for a new asphalt shingle roof on a single-family home in Viola?

For a standard-sized home in Viola (approx. 1,500-2,000 sq ft), a complete asphalt shingle roof replacement typically ranges from $8,500 to $15,000. This range accounts for local material and labor costs, the complexity of your roof's design (like valleys or dormers common in older Viola homes), and the quality of shingles chosen. Illinois' climate demands durable, wind-resistant shingles, which can influence the final price.

2When is the best time of year to schedule a roof replacement in the Viola area?

The ideal windows are late spring (May-June) and early fall (September-October). These periods typically offer the mild, dry weather needed for proper installation and material adhesion. Scheduling outside of the peak summer heat and avoiding the volatile spring storm season common in the Midwest helps ensure project timelines stay on track and protects your home during the vulnerable reroofing process.

3Are there any local Viola or Illinois regulations I need to be aware of for a roofing project?

Yes. In Viola, you will likely need a building permit from the Village of Viola or Mercer County for a full roof replacement. Furthermore, Illinois law requires roofing contractors to be licensed and insured. It's crucial to hire a provider who is familiar with local codes, which may include specific requirements for ice and water shield installation given our freeze-thaw cycles and for proper attic ventilation to meet energy codes.

4How do I choose a reliable roofing contractor in the Viola and Mercer County area?

Prioritize contractors with a strong local reputation, verifiable Illinois roofing license, and proof of insurance (liability and workers' comp). Ask for references from recent projects in Viola or nearby towns like Aledo, and check for membership in local business associations. A trustworthy roofer will provide a detailed, written estimate, explain the specific materials suited for our climate, and offer a robust warranty on both materials and workmanship.

5What are the most common roofing problems for homes in Viola due to the local climate?

The most frequent issues stem from Illinois' seasonal extremes. These include wind damage from strong spring and summer storms, ice dam formation in winter due to freeze-thaw cycles, and general wear from thermal expansion and contraction. Proactive maintenance, such as cleaning gutters to prevent ice dams and inspecting for loose shingles after major storms, is key to extending your roof's lifespan in our region.
